GP surgery in Bristol, City of
The Armada Family Practice
Whitchurch Health Centre, Armada Road, Bristol, BS14 0SU
Scores 5 out of 100, poor for a GP surgery in England. 61% of patients say their experience is good and 27% find it easy to get through on the phone (England: 77% and 57%). Inspectors rated it Requires improvement in 2026. It is taking on new patients.

Common questions
Is The Armada Family Practice taking on new patients?
Yes. When we last checked its page on the NHS website (20 September 2026), The Armada Family Practice was taking on new patients. You can register online through the NHS website or call the surgery on 01275 832285.
How do patients rate The Armada Family Practice?
In the 2026 NHS GP Patient Survey, 61% of patients at The Armada Family Practice said their overall experience was good. The England average is 77%. 27% found it easy to get through by phone (England 57%). Its GPScore is 5 out of 100, grade E, which puts it in the bottom 20% of GP surgeries in England.
What is the inspection rating for The Armada Family Practice?
The Care Quality Commission, which inspects GP surgeries in England, rated The Armada Family Practice as Requires improvement at its last published inspection (report published 25 June 2026).
